Rooney may have been scoring at 16 for Everton but Everton is a Mid-Table club in the Premiereship and Rooney was neither starting for nor scoring often for them. I believe his career high total was 7 goals in the League before Joining United as an 18 year old(which is when Freddie will leave MLS, because then he will be allowed to sign a full Porfessional contract). All these players you mention as producing at the same age as Adu are actually 2 years or more older than the kid. And I believe we can all attest to the differences physically and in overall maturation between what is a Sophomore in high school and a Senior in Highschool/Freshman in college.

 

To be honest Freddie would actually probably benefit more from riding the bench in Europe with one of their top teams and training everyday with the best in the world than he would playing with players in MLS who will never be as good as Freddie soon will be. Look at Steven Gerrard, Rooney and Michael Owen. Each of these kids was an exceptional talent who was brought into their clubs Youth Academy at a very young age. They didn't play with their first team very often at 15, or 16 but by the time they were 17, or 18 they were regulars. These 3 of course are prodigies beyond most comparison but it shows that you don't have to get regular first team games when you are 16 to develop into a top flight player as you get older. You just the apporpriate atmosphere and to be playing with the best on a daily basis
